Your Role:
• Work closely with Product Managers, Designers, developers, and other User Researchers to plan and conduct high-impact research that helps develop a better understanding of our clients’ users.
• Contribute to creating better products and services that solve users’ problems and meets their needs.
• Lead the research for your team, suggesting the best approaches and methodologies to use to capture the right user insights.
• Plan and run qualitative studies, including remote and in person interviews, observations, diary studies, concept testing and usability studies.
• Use quantitative methods such as surveys to identify actionable insights and collaborate with the analytics team to enhance qualitative insights.
• Consider the end-to-end user journey and external factors that may impact the user experience including business, policy, and technical constraints.
• Communicate research findings and involve your team in analysis and synthesis to develop empathy with the users and enable evidence-based design decisions.
• Help to embed user-centred design and user research best practices into teams and the wider business.
What you will do:
Essential:
• Hands-on experience of leading user research, using behavioural and attitudinal methods and knowing when to apply them appropriately.
• Experience across multiple phases of a product or service lifecycle, from discovery and exploration through to design and delivery.
• You will either already have SC (Security Check) Clearance or you are able to qualify for this level of clearance (by being a UK resident for 5 years+ and not having left the country for more than 28 days or longer in the last 5 years)
• Experience working with Government Digital Service (GDS) service standards, using GDS design principles
• Strong storytelling, communication, stakeholder management, and facilitation skills.
• Experience working in multi-disciplinary, agile teams where you’ve led the user research and influenced the design of a product or service through the insights you’ve gathered.
• Familiarity with using prototypes to test hypotheses, assumptions and validate user journeys.
• Understanding of a range of tools and practices for in-person and remote research.
